Understanding Ice Retention: The Basics

What Influences Ice Retention?

Ice retention depends on several key factors including cooler insulation quality, ambient temperature, cooler load, and packing techniques. High-end models often use thicker walls and rigid insulation materials to slow heat transfer. Essential Cooler Maintenance for Longevity and Ice Retention

Routine Cleaning to Maintain Seal Integrity

Dirt and debris can compromise gasket seals, leading to air leaks that reduce ice retention. Cleaning with mild detergents and inspecting seals regularly is non-negotiable for performance. Detailed cleaning instructions are provided in how to clean and maintain coolers.

Lubricate Gaskets for Better Sealing

Applying silicone-based lubricants ensures the gasket remains flexible and airtight. Avoid petroleum products that degrade rubber. This basic upkeep step is often overlooked but critical for maximizing ice life.

Advanced Ice Packing Techniques

Use Block Ice and Gel Packs Smartly

Block ice melts slower due to lower surface area, and gel packs provide stability without excess water mess. Mixing the two can optimize duration and cooling efficiency. For product recommendations, see our best gel packs for coolers guide.

Layering for Thermal Efficiency

Start with a base layer of ice, then add your items, topped with more ice, minimizing air pockets. Avoid trying to cram air space which accelerates melting. Our analysis on thermal packing methods explores this further.

Reduce Lid Opening Frequency

Maintenance Checklist for Year-Round Ice Retention

Task Frequency Tools/Materials Needed Benefit
Clean Cooler Interior & Gasket After each trip Mild detergent, soft cloth Prevents odor, preserves airtight seal
Inspect & Lubricate Gasket Quarterly Silicone lubricant Maintains seal flexibility, prevents leaks
Check Drain Plug & Seals Pre-trip Wrench, replacement seals if needed Ensures no water leakage, maximizes insulation
Store with Lid Open in Dry Area Between uses None Prevents mildew and warping
Pre-chill Cooler Before Use Before each trip Ice or cold water Reduces ice melting during initial hours

Frequently Asked Questions

How long can I expect ice to last in a premium hard cooler during summer?

With proper packing and limited lid openings, premium hard coolers with thick insulation can retain ice for 3 to 5 days, depending on ambient temperature and ice quality.

Should I prefer block ice over crushed ice for better ice retention?

Yes. Block ice has a lower surface area to volume ratio, which means it melts slower than crushed or cubed ice, significantly improving ice retention.

Is it important to pre-chill my cooler before adding ice?

Absolutely. Pre-chilling lowers the cooler's internal temperature, preventing the ice from melting quickly upon initial placement.

Can electric coolers replace ice completely?

Electric coolers actively maintain cold temperatures but require a steady power source. They are a great supplement but may struggle to match ice retention times of high-end hard coolers for multi-day trips.

How often should I inspect and maintain my cooler's seals?

It's recommended to inspect and lubricate seals quarterly to ensure they remain flexible and airtight, which is crucial for maintaining ice retention efficiency.
